South End, Fall River,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South End?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| South End Studio Apartments | $1,741 | $1,695 | $1,860 |
| South End 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,697 | $950 | $2,195 |
| South End 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,841 | $1,100 | $2,800 |
| South End 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,903 | $1,400 | $2,595 |
| South End 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,400 | $2,400 | $2,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about South End Apartments with Hardwood Floors
What is the Cheapest Hardwood Floors apartment in South End?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in South End with Hardwood Floors is at Lafayette Lofts listed at $1,550.
How much is the average rent for South End Apartments with Hardwood Floors?
The average rent for a Apartment in South End with Hardwood Floors is $2,036.
What is the largest South End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?
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in South End is a 1,565 square feet unit starting from $1,710 at King Philip Lofts.
What is the average size for South End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?
The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in South End is currently at 698 sq ft.
